Tortoisesvn provides a nice and easy user interface for subversion. The merge plugin for subversion is included with merge and enables merge to access files located within a subversion repository. Make repository with svn server and tortoise svn in windows system. Select fully recursive from the dropdown shown in the image. My issue is that when i choose to merge reintegrate a branch, tortoises edit conflict button is grayed out. If you needwant to use uselogauthor or addauthorfrom, please set those in git config cf.
Install just tortoisemerge software and context menu items. Now, select newbranch and mergetortoisesvnmergepicture3 6. Tortoisesvn tortoisesvn is a subversion svn client, implemented as a windows shell extension. Simply the coolest interface to subversion control. Remember that when using tortoise svn, the revision range begins with the last revision that has not been merged. Click, showlog to select required revisions you intrested onpicture5. Changes done by others will be merged into your files, keeping any changes you. So its better to leave it as is and let the user configure. This extension also displays some contextual menus to open tortoisesvn repository browser, log viewer and blame viewer when right clicking on a url. Subversion is a popular opensource version control tool. Tortoisesvn 64bit is a really easy to use revision controlversion controlsource control software for windows. First download the keys as well as the asc signature file for the particular distribution.
An apache svn client, right where you need it most. As it works as a windows shell extension, all its commands are available via the rightclick command of your system. Using the plugin, you can for example perform a folder comparison to compare the subversion repository against your local workspace. List of commits all tortoisesvn svn tortoisesvn osdn. In fact, you can think of this tutorial as a set of tortoisesvn water wings, aimed at developers who have been thrown into subversion at. Make sure you get these files from the main distribution directory, rather than from a mirror. Issue tracker pluginsplugins zur verbindung mit issue trackern. Exports the filefolder to the repository svn export all to here. We right click and go to tortoise svn and select merge. Tortoisesvn 64bit download 2020 latest for windows 10. It comes by default with most of the gnulinux distributions, so it might be already installed on your system.
Subversion has since expanded beyond its original goal of replacing cvs, but its basic model, design, and interface remain heavily influenced by that goal. This extension enables you to open a file directly in tortoisesvn instead of in the browser. Install just tortoisemerge software and context menu items stack. On x64 versions of windows 7 and 8, the tortoisesvn context menu and overlays wont show for 32bit applications in their fileopensave dialogs until you install the 2017 cruntime for x86. Use a sync merge to keep your branch uptodate as you work. If you are merging revisions in chunks, the method shown in the subversion book will have you merge 100200 this time and 200300 next time. It is opensource and available for free over the internet. Select default merge a range of revision, to select revisions which you only intrested to merge. Tortoisesvn is an apache subversion svn client, implemented as a windows shell extension. Update your working copy with changes from others tortoisesvn. Foreword viii foreword subversion is one of the most commonlyused source control systems that is used today for professional development work, and michael sorens book is a great way to learn the practicalities of. Svn basics setting up the tortoise svn client and svn import duration.
In tortoisemerge, when you search for a whole word, it does not fi. The button is available if i choose to use tortoises diff utility. Branching and merging are fundamental aspects of version control, simple enough to explain conceptually but offering just enough complexity and nuance to merit their own chapter in this book. Merge two svn repositories posted on 20919 by gerhard there was a point in time when i created a copy of a project and it was then committed into another repository. Setting up the tortoise svn client and svn import duration.
Tortoisesvn branchmerge workflow tutorial duration. Even though perforce is obviously not free the merge tool is. If you want a copy of the source code, you have to use tortoisesvn itself or any other subversion client to check out a working copy. It normally ends with the head revision, but in this case we choose a lower revision 36800 first. Merge two svn repositories experiencing technology. It doesnt take too much setting up to use with tortoisesvn. Copies the filefolder from source to destination as a new file. Both branches have been changed since they diverged.
When you click on a link to one of the registered urls, tortoisesvn repository browser will open. Exports all the files and folders in the source directory to the repository copy here. Tortoisesvn will contact its download site periodically to see if there is a newer. Now that we have made the change, we need to merge it to the trunk. We delete the development branch after the trunk name. Tortoisesvn is a subversion svn client, implemented as a windows shell extension.
Below instructions would give you instructions about how to configure tortoise svn to use diffmerge tool for viewing file differences, merging files and resolving conflicts. I am trying to diff excel files if that makes a difference. Using tortoisesvn to branch and merge on windows 10 duration. To integrate with tortoisesvn set the merge tool to. In this last dialog, choose the merge depth, that is what parts of your local copy are to be. Herein, well introduce you to the general ideas behind these operations as well as subversions somewhat unique approach to them. And it is free to use, even in a commercial environment. Tortoisesvn is built on subversion, a very popular open source version control system that is known for its reliability, scalability, and flexibility for enterprises of all sizes. The go to next diff in tortoisemerge stopped at lines filtered with a regex. Many teams are still using subversion svn and the tortoisesvn client. Tortoisesvn is an easytouse scm source control software for microsoft windows and possibly the best standalone apache subversion client there is.
Use svn merge to send your changes back to the trunk. In the merge dialog, the default behaviour is for the from. This difference has generated a lot of heat on the mailing lists. Tortoisesvn is an easytouse versionsource control client for windows it is developed under the gpl so its completely free to use. Its intuitive and easy to use, since it doesnt require the subversion command line client to run. Svn tortoise tutorial for git, local and also learn. It is recommended that you run gitsvn fetch and rebase not pull or merge your commits against the latest changes in the svn repository. This is an introduction to subversion, using wandiscos ubersvn and the trusty windows client, tortoisesvn. Code compare integration with tortoisesvn to integrate our diff and merge tool into tortoisesvn, perform the following steps. Right click on the folder and go to tortoise svn and select switch. Perform svn update inside teamso newbranch is updated. Repository summary tortoisesvn svn tortoisesvn osdn.
But add solution wizard, get solution command and visual studio integration status icons, transparent file. Merging is difficult and can be timeconsuming due to lack of tracking of source and destination branches. Adds the filefolder as a new file to the working copy svn export to here. Download and install source gear diff merge tool from the below location.
Using tortoisesvn to branch and merge on windows 10 youtube. I can download them standalone as a zip, but i really love when ii can select two files and then right click and from context menu click on diff in tortoise. Select tortoise svn settings from the tortoisesvn popup menu in windows explorer. The most common complaints about svn is its tedious branching and complicated merging model. This will create a revision in svn for each commit in git.
Although most people just download the installer, you also have full read access to the. When the merge is committed the server stores that information in a database, and when you request merge, log or blame information, the server can respond appropriately. How to install tortoise svn in windows 7 8 10 youtube. This tutorial show you how to setup svn server with tortoise svn. Which means it is completely free for anyone to use, including in a commercial environment, without any restriction. Visualsvn uses tortoisesvn for most of the dialogs. Basic concepts viewing and merging differences editing conflicts applying patches 3. It shows you the two versions of a file sidebyside, coloring every modified line in that file. Apache subversion is a fullfeatured version control system originally designed to be a better cvs. If i merge them, only the changes of one of them obtain and those of the other will be overwritten. With tortoisesvn you would merge 100200 this time and 200 next time.
103 676 143 98 853 686 1083 405 1022 607 491 1561 592 449 649 1213 1140 1028 497 1092 1376 717 1019 738 958 999 1584 277 870 115 1100 841 733 1001 63 511 277 86 977